Can someone tell me the difference between a Photoshop template and an HTML template and what is the advantage of one over the other. I noticed on some Photoshop templates, it looks like some stuff is editable and some is not. Do you have to look around and find something with the same theme as what your site is?

I dont completely understand your question, mainly because a photoshop template will have to be turned into an HTML template to be viewed.

A photoshop template simply by itself is just an image (a .psd to be exact). An HTML template is a template that has been coded, probably from an existing photoshop template.

To sum it all up (it pretty much is already, but meh)

A Photoshop template is an image created in Photoshop.

An HTML template is an actual template that is coded and ready for use.

A photoshop template is indeed just a photoshop file .psd which you either can make yourself if you have some designing skills, or you can buy/download somewhere.

The main difference between the 2 is that within photoshop all elements are still moveable and free to edit to your own liking. Once it's in HTML things are all in "boxes" and if you would want to switch the header with the footer for instance, it wouldn't be a matter of a few clicks but a matter of building an entire new layout.
